Output 58c7bb8a2d4ada6622d63f1e3a348e2d0182a8837cd7eb74c01b28ce98f7dba0:6

value
377279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bcf209b0ba2c28dd188fc972d09d424eaf872a0 OP_EQUAL
address
3CyfAbnaF8EFrBVdJmfF38XHhBtjA4GVzr
transaction
58c7bb8a2d4ada6622d63f1e3a348e2d0182a8837cd7eb74c01b28ce98f7dba0
spent
true